CSS CODE HELP NEEDED
I cannot perform a search for the Web Design thread this morning, so I'll (cross-)post this here in the hope that I'll get a good answer.
Please consider www.eigen.com. See the bold blue text (e.g., "Experience Artemis in action!") in the middle column (Eigen Updates)? I need it to have the same teal color (#007F9E) as the adjacent hyperlinks. Right now the text is in a conventional <p> text block and uses <strong> as the style.
I've been wrestling with this for an hour and a half this morning, have looked at several W3C pages and still can't get a handle on it. Are any of you CSS code jockeys?
I'm using an external CSS page; here is a snippet that controls stuff in this column:
#updates { display: block; background-color: #FFFFFF; padding: 10px; width: 300px; float: left; height: 520px; color: #000000; }#updates h6 { font-size: 12px; font-weight: bold; }
